How does a drain field function in a septic system?

Explanation:
The drain field, also known as the leach field or absorption field, plays a critical role in a septic system by dispersing the liquid effluent that flows from the septic tank into the surrounding soil. After the septic tank separates solids from the liquid waste and the anaerobic digestion process takes place, the remaining liquid effluent is nutrient-rich and needs further treatment. When the effluent enters the drain field, it is evenly distributed through a network of perforated pipes laid within gravel-filled trenches. This design allows the effluent to percolate through the soil, where natural processes further filter and treat the wastewater. Soil microorganisms break down organic matter, pathogens, and nutrients, effectively purifying the effluent before it eventually reenters the groundwater system. The function of the drain field is essential to preventing contamination of nearby water sources and ensuring that the wastewater is treated adequately before it is released back into the environment.
